Cultural activities\u2014including sipping coffee at a corner caf\u00e9, visiting artisan markets in Chordeleg or Gualaceo, or attending a local craft fair\u2014allow you to enjoy Ecuadorian life while keeping movement minimal and stress low.<\/p>\n<h2>How to Plan Your Perfect Dental Vacation in Cuenca<\/h2>\n<p>Planning a dental vacation requires a blend of medical logistics and travel planning. Below is a practical roadmap to help you organize a safe, efficient, and restorative experience.<\/p>\n<h3>Step 1: Do Your Research and Choose a Clinic<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>Look for clinics with clear portfolios: before-and-after photos, patient testimonials and transparent pricing.<\/li>\n<li>Ask about training and certifications\u2014confirm dentists\u2019 education and any specialist training or international certifications.<\/li>\n<li>Verify technology and techniques used (CBCT, digital scanning, implant brands) and ask to see the sterilization protocols.<\/li>\n<li>Check language capabilities: many clinics offer bilingual coordinators and teleconsults in English.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Step 2: Send Records and Book a Virtual Consult<\/h3>\n<p>Before you travel, most reputable clinics will request your dental records and recent X-rays or CBCT scans. If you don\u2019t have digital images, clinics can advise what to obtain locally. A virtual consult lets the dentist propose treatment options, an estimated price, and a realistic timeline\u2014crucial for travel planning.<\/p>\n<h3>Step 3: Plan Your Timeline<\/h3>\n<p>Typical timelines vary depending on the complexity of the case: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Single implant with delayed crown: initial consult and implant placement, 3\u20134 months healing, return for final crown\u2014or have the crown made in Cuenca if you prefer to stay longer.<\/li>\n<li>Immediate-load implants or same-day teeth: some clinics offer protocols that allow provisional teeth the same day of placement; final restorations may follow after a healing period.<\/li>\n<li>Full-arch restorations: expect a 2\u20133 week visit for surgery and provisional prosthesis, with follow-ups scheduled over months for final work.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Many patients combine an initial 7\u201314 day stay for surgery and immediate follow-up, then schedule a shorter return trip for final restorations\u2014or arrange for local labs in their home country to finalize restorations if warranty and compatibility allow.<\/p>\n<h2>Sample Two-Week Itinerary for Dental Implants<\/h2>\n<p>Here\u2019s a practical sample itinerary for someone getting one or two implants with crowns crafted in Cuenca: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Day 1: Arrival at Mariscal Lamar (CUE) \u2013 settle into hotel in Historic Center<\/li>\n<li>Day 2: Pre-surgical consult, CBCT scan, and treatment planning<\/li>\n<li>Day 3: Implant surgery (local anesthesia or conscious sedation) \u2013 rest and light activities<\/li>\n<li>Day 4\u20137: Recovery days \u2013 gentle walks, soft foods, and short excursions to nearby markets or museums<\/li>\n<li>Day 8: Post-op check and suture removal (if applicable)<\/li>\n<li>Days 9\u201312: Optional sightseeing to Cajas National Park or artisan villages\u2014avoid strenuous activity<\/li>\n<li>Day 13: Final impressions for crown \/ digital scan<\/li>\n<li>Day 14: Delivery of crown (if same-visit) or final instructions and discharge<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>For more complex or multiple implants, add 1\u20133 weeks for lab work and healing, or plan a short second trip for final restorations.<\/p>\n<h2>Choosing Where to Stay and How to Get Around<\/h2>\n<p>Stay close to Parque Calder\u00f3n in El Centro Hist\u00f3rico for easy access to restaurants, pharmacies, and clinics. If you prefer quieter neighborhoods with views, Turi and Yanuncay offer boutique hotels and private rentals. Cuenca\u2019s airport (Mariscal Lamar) is small and efficient; most visitors connect through Quito or Guayaquil. Taxis are affordable, and many clinics provide pickup and drop-off services. For short recovery periods, choose accommodation with comfortable bedding, reliable Wi-Fi for telehealth follow-ups, and a kitchen if you prefer soft meals.<\/p>\n<h2>What to Pack and Documentation Tips<\/h2>\n<ul>\n<li>Passport and copies; any medical insurance details<\/li>\n<li>All current dental records, X-rays, or scans in digital format if possible<\/li>\n<li>List of medications and allergies<\/li>\n<li>Comfortable clothing, travel pillow and a small cooler for cold packs<\/li>\n<li>Over-the-counter pain relievers you commonly use (check with your clinician)<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Also confirm payment methods with your clinic\u2014many accept international cards, wire transfers, or cash.
